Quarterly Planning Note — Divestiture of the Coastal Tooling Unit

For the finance team: the sale of the Coastal Tooling unit to Pellmark Industries remains on track for close in Q3. Please finalize the carve-out balance sheet, reconcile intercompany positions, and prepare the working-capital adjustment schedule by month-end. Audit support requests should be prioritized. For planning purposes, note the following sensitive item:

internal memo for hawef-kahif: The finance team signed off on a budget of $25.9 million for Project Sorox. The renewal with Pelokek Logistics closes at $51.7 million a year, 52 percent below the last contract.

**Action item 4: Fix tailcat's buffer blowup (owner: platform crew)**

During the Marlowe outage, half the responders ran `tailcat --follow` against the firehose and promptly OOM'd their laptops, because the CLI buffers everything when the terminal can't keep up. We need a bounded ring buffer and a loud warning when lines get dropped. Future maintainers: please don't "fix" this by raising the buffer cap again — that's how we got here. Design sketch, benchmarks, and the rollout plan are written up on the internal page below:

wiki page, fajof-tajef: https://vault.tolvaqio.corp/board/pipeline/pages/ticket/c20d7f984bcc9e12

☐ Escort the new starter to the Larchwood Studio on level 3 before their 10:00 orientation. Confirm the recording lights are off, sign them into the studio logbook, and show them where the lapel mics are stored. The studio door stays locked at all times, so make sure they note down the keypad entry code below.

door code, yagap-bahof: bdg-O-05